With a Delta E of 23.8, these colors are very different. RAL 660-5 belongs to the Blue family while RAL 740-4 belongs to the Cyan family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 660-5 is brighter with an LRV of 46.1 compared to 19.8 for RAL 740-4. RAL 660-5 is more saturated (48%) than RAL 740-4 (21%).
